In brief

Recent reporting suggests the FBI may be stepping back from investigations involving Immigration and Customs Enforcement confrontations, potentially affecting oversight mechanisms. However, both the Department of Justice and Department of Homeland Security have publicly refuted claims of any formal policy shift. This development raises questions about accountability practices within federal immigration enforcement agencies and the coordination between law enforcement bodies.
